James and Craig were fed up with paying unnecessary bank fees every time they travelled.
The alternatives weren’t much better: prepaid cards, extra accounts, constant top-ups and too much friction.
There had to be a simpler way to spend abroad. So they built it.

Currensea launched in 2020 as the UK’s first direct debit travel card. It connects securely to your current account and lets you spend abroad in local currency without the sneaky high-street banks’ FX fees.
There’s no new bank account to open, and no prepaid balance to manage. Just travel money, made easy.
